Lemon Chicken Pasta Ingredients
For the Chicken
-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
For the Pasta
- 12 ounces fettuccine, linguine, or penne
- Water for boiling
- 1 tablespoon salt for pasta water
For the Lemon Sauce
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 cup heavy cream
- ½ cup chicken broth
- 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- Juice of 1 large lemon
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
- Extra Parmesan for serving

How to Make Lemon Chicken Pasta
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ook until al dente according to the package instructions. Before draining, reserve about 1 cup of the pasta water. Drain the pasta and set it aside.
Step 2: Season and Cook the Chicken
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els. Season both sides with sal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and Italian seasoning.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the chicken for 5–7 minutes per side, or until golden brown and fully cooked. Transfer the chicken to a plate and let it rest for 5 minutes before slicing it into thin strips.
Step 3: Make the Lemon Cream Sauce
Using the same sk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for about 1 minute until fragrant. Pour in the chicken broth and stir well, scraping any browned bits from the bottom of the pan. Add the heavy cream and let it simmer gently for 3–4 minutes. Stir in the Parmesan cheese until melted, then add the lemon juice and lemon zest. Mix until the sauce becomes smooth and creamy.
Step 4: Combine the Pasta and Sauce
Add the cooked pasta to the skillet and toss until every piece is coated in the creamy lemon sauce. If the sauce seems too thick, add a little reserved pasta water until it reaches the desired consistency.
Step 5: Add the Chicken
Return the sliced chicken to the skillet and gently mix everything together. Sprinkle with fresh parsley and let everything cook together for another 1–2 minutes so the flavors blend perfectly.

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Serve the Lemon Chicken Pasta immediately while hot. Garnish with extra grated Parmesan cheese, fresh parsley, and an extra squeeze of lemon juice if desired. Enjoy with garlic bread or a fresh green salad.

Tips and Shortcuts
- Use rotisserie chicken to save time instead of cooking chicken from scratch.
- Cook the pasta while the chicken cooks so everything is ready at the same time.
- Use freshly grated Parmesan for the smoothest sauce and the best flavor.
- Fresh lemon juice and zest give a brighter taste than bottled lemon juice.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ts ?
Yes! Boneless, skinless chicken thighs are juicy, flavorful, and work just as well in this recipe.
What is the best pasta for Lemon Chicken Pasta ?
Fettuccine, linguine, penne, spaghetti, and bow tie pasta are all excellent choices.
Can I use milk instead of heavy cream ?
Yes, but the sauce will be thinner and less creamy. Whole milk works better than low-fat milk.
How can I make the sauce thicker ?
Let the sauce simmer for a few extra minutes or stir in a little more grated Parmesan cheese.
How to Store Leftovers
Refrigerator Storage
Let the Lemon Chicken Pasta cool completely before storing it. Transfer the leftovers to an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 4 days. To reheat, warm it g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, adding a splash of milk, cream, or chicken broth to restore the creamy texture.
Freezer Storage
Place the cooled pasta in a freezer-safe container or freezer bag and fre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w it overnight in the refrigerator before reheating. Warm it slowly over low heat, stirring occasionally and adding a little milk or chicken broth if the sauce has thickened.
